    Deep Scratches in Wood Table: Professional Cleaning and Repair Tips

    Deep scratches in a wood table can significantly detract from its appearance. To effectively clean and repair these scratches, you can use a combination of specialized products and techniques.     Essential Tools and Materials for Scratch Repair

    Before starting the repair process, gather the necessary tools and materials. Having everything ready will streamline your efforts and ensure a successful outcome. Here’s what you will need:

    Item Purpose
    Wood filler Fills deep scratches
    Sandpaper Smooths surface
    Wood stain Matches existing color
    Clear coat Seals and protects
    Soft cloth Applies products
    Putty knife Applies filler

    Repair Preparation and Safety Guidelines

    Proper preparation is essential for a successful repair. Ensure the work area is well-ventilated and free from dust. Wear gloves to protect your hands from chemicals in wood fillers and stains.

    • Clean the surface thoroughly to remove dust and grease.

    • Assess the depth of the scratches to determine the right approach.

    • Test any products on an inconspicuous area first.

    Master Execution of Scratch Repair

    Follow these steps to effectively repair deep scratches in your wood table. Each step is crucial for restoring the table’s appearance.

    1. Clean the area with a soft cloth to remove any debris.

    2. Apply wood filler using a putty knife to fill the scratch. Ensure it overfills slightly.

    3. Let the filler dry completely as per the manufacturer’s instructions.

    4. Sand the area gently with fine-grit sandpaper until smooth and level with the surrounding wood.

    5. Stain the filled area to match the existing wood color. Use a soft cloth for even application.

    6. Seal the repair with a clear coat to protect the surface and enhance durability.

    Quick Fixes for Surface Scratches

    Surface scratches can often be addressed with simpler methods. Here are some quick fixes that can help.

    • Use a walnut: Rubbing a walnut over light scratches can help fill them in due to its natural oils.

    • Apply furniture polish: A high-quality polish can help mask minor scratches and restore shine.

    • Use a crayon: Matching the crayon color to your wood can effectively fill in small scratches.

    Scratch Prevention Strategies for Wood Tables

    Taking steps to prevent future scratches is just as important as repairing existing ones. Here are some effective strategies.

    • Use coasters: Always place drinks on coasters to avoid rings and scratches.

    • Avoid direct sunlight: Position tables away from direct sunlight to prevent fading and warping.

    • Regular maintenance: Periodically clean and polish your table to maintain its finish.
